Abstract

It is described an electronic portable apparatus (P), such as a communication, information or entertainment apparatus, usable in a system or a method for using services delivered by a plurality of providers to a user showing an electronic card having stored therein a set of data and/or applications functional to the service desired. The apparatus comprises integrated memory means (M), adapted to store a plurality of complete sets of data and/or applications (DI-DN), each being adapted to identify a programming configuration for an electronic card (C), adapted to have said card operate according to a respective service destination. The apparatus (P) is arranged to transfer a selected complete set of data and/or applications (Di;...; DN) to the non-volatile storage medium (50) of a multi-purpose programmable universal electronic card (C), associable thereto, so as to program said card (C) for a predetermined service destination. The card (C) is unique and intended for using a plurality of services, according to the temporary programming configuration taken.

An electronic portable apparatus for use with a programmable multi-purpose electronic card, a programmable multi-purpose electronic card, as well as a system and method for using services by means of said card
The present invention relates to the use of services delivered to a user showing an electronic card having stored therein a set of data or applications functional to a desired service. In particular, the invention relates to an electronic portable apparatus, such as for example a communication, information or entertainment apparatus, and a programmable multi-purpose electronic card, adapted to be associated to an electronic portable apparatus for using services.
The unstoppable development of electronic data processing technology has made available the use of several services by a user that shows an electronic card having stored therein a set of data or applications functional to the required service. Electronic payment cards (credit or debit cards), electronic authorisation cards (driving licenses or for carrying out predetermined activities, for accessing places subject to restriction), electronic personal identification cards (identity card for the citizen, for students or specific categories), electronic association cards (for organizations, associations, chains of shops, transport companies), electronic cards for using commercial services in general, are increasingly widespread. Each of them carries stored information (data or applications), often confidential, aimed at allowing the supply of a predetermined service associated with that card.
Many people therefore carry with them a considerable number of electronic cards, which implies a certain labour in searching and showing the right one for the service required, as well as considerable overall dimensions as there is the need of always carrying a cumbersome holder for keeping all the cards.
At the same time, a large number of electronic devices for communication, information and entertainment have become available, such as phone apparatus, positioning and navigation systems, audio or video players and recorders, with increasingly more compact dimensions, for being carried along by the owners in any mobility condition. The importance of being able to communicate anywhere and anytime has actually led to the spreading of portable phone apparatus, which nowadays are essential to almost anybody.
US 2009/0065571 describes a system and a process for executing financial transactions through a wireless connection, wherein an intelligent card is paired with a host mobile device whereby a user can authorise the transactions and display the relevant information. The pairing between card and host device can provide for the transfer of some data between the two components, for example the update of the host device signature or of the transaction data on a local memory of the card, or the installation or execution of an application on the host device for customising such device in the use of the card, but without ever providing for the complete transfer of data and operating applications from the card to the host device and the programming of a different card, temporarily without configuration, for a similar financial transaction service.
US 2002/0177407 describes a portable phone provided with a microprocessor card for using various types of electronic commerce services. The card, configured for using electronic commerce services, is arranged for receiving partial data identifying goods or services object of an electronic commerce operation (for example, the identification data of an electronic ticket that may be purchased online, or the data indicating free points to access free goods or discounts in commercial services) through the portable phone, which constitutes a means for connecting the card to a remote service supplier through a radio communication network.
EP 0 872 816 describes a portable device for processing the information stored on a microprocessor card used as portable electronic money support. The device is arranged for reading and writing a part of the information on the card, for example the change of passwords or personal information on the card user. However, it is not possible to change the card use purpose.
The present invention aims at providing a solution that could meet the need of an easier use of a plurality of services through an electronic card, preventing the drawbacks of the prior art. According to the present invention, such object is achieved thanks to an electronic portable apparatus having the features described in claim 1.
Particular embodiments are the subject of the dependent claims, whose content is to be understood as an integral and integrating part of the present description.
Further subjects of the invention are a programmable multi-purpose electronic card, as well as a system and a method for using services delivered to a user showing a programmable multi-purpose electronic card, as claimed.
In brief, the present invention is based on the principle of having a single universal, programmable, multi-purpose electronic card intended for using a plurality of services, in other words having a plurality of functional destinations, and assigning to memory means integrated in a single electronic portable apparatus, such as a communication, information or entertainment apparatus, the task of storing the information relating to the different functional (service) destinations, which would instead be stored into respective electronic cards, and of transferring such information, unchanged, upon a temporary programming of the card to make such card operational according to a predetermined corresponding service destination, for the occasional use thereof only.
Advantageously, it is thus possible to do without a large number of different electronic cards which would otherwise be subject to being forgotten into separate cases. Preferably, the electronic portable apparatus adapted to program the universal electronic card is a portable telephone apparatus, a device that for its functionality and versatility, everybody tends not to forget and always have along.

An electronic portable apparatus, in the example a portable telephone apparatus P, configured according to the invention, is shown in Figures Ia-Ic, in association with an electronic programmable card C.
The apparatus has a case 10 of traditional parallelepiped shape, provided on at least one main face with interface means with a user, for example an authorised user of the apparatus, or a subject authorised by a supplier of a predetermined service, for example a service for the use whereof the supplier has issued an original electronic card in favour of such subject. The interface means include a plurality of control buttons 20 or touch screen areas 30, for the input of data or controls, as well as graphical display means 40 for displaying available application tools or data, conveniently identified by a corresponding icon, to the user.
The electronic programmable card C is provided with at least one non-volatile and rewritable storage medium 50 for the temporary electromagnetic storage of information. Such information comprise a complete set of data and/or applications adapted to identify a temporary programming configuration of the card, adapted to have said card operate according to a respective predetermined service destination. The above sets of data and/or applications are for example adapted to identify a programming configuration having a functional destination selected from the group comprising the functional destinations of an electronic payment card, an electronic authorisation card, an electronic personal identification card, an electronic association card, an electronic card for using commercial services.
The storage medium 50 for example, but not exclusively, is an electronic chip embedded on the card, a magnetic band incorporated in the card, an optical track engraved onto the card, or a combination thereof, and is accessible in reading and writing by contact or via radio in proximity.
Apparatus P is further provided with means for the temporary housing of an electronic programmable card C, adapted to move the card in contact with read/write means of the storage medium 50. In a currently preferred embodiment shown in the Figure, they include a seat for housing the card at least partly defined within case 10 of the telephone apparatus and accessible through a slit 60 obtained on a face of the case. The seat is associated to means for automatically or manually ejecting card 70, adapted to allow the card withdrawal by a user, for example for a use thereof.
Of course, other embodiments may be provided for the temporary housing of card C, for example a simple seat for resting the card on a face of case 10, wherefrom the read/write means physically emerge or are facing through an optical or electromagnetic window.
The images show a use sequence of the apparatus. In Figure Ia, the apparatus houses the programmable multi-purpose electronic card C, for example for the configuration thereof or simply for the storage thereof when not in use. Figure Ib shows condition of partial removal of the card which may be obtained by actuating the ejection means, after which a user can take the card by the exposed edge and withdraw it fully, for its use in view of accessing to a specific service for which it has been programmed (arranged). Figure Ic shows the card in extracted condition, for example after the use and in view of a reintroduction into the apparatus for reprogramming according to a different functional destination.
Figure 2 shows a simplified block diagram of a system for using services according to the invention.
The portable telephone apparatus P (or other equivalent electronic portable apparatus) comprises a processing and control unit CPU whereto one or more integrated memory modules M are associated, adapted to store, without possibility of changes by a user, a plurality of complete sets of data and/or applications DJ-DN, each set being adapted for identifying a distinct programming configuration of a rewritable electronic card, adapted to have said card operate according to a predetermined functional or service destination.
The interface means of apparatus P as a whole constitute means SEL for selecting a complete set of data or applications identifying a desired programming configuration of an electronic card C temporarily associated with the apparatus, which are also coupled in communication with the processing unit CPU.
In particular, they are adapted to represent a selection menu comprising the set of functional destinations assignable to the card and receive the selection of a specific functional destination of the card from a user of the apparatus, whereto a respective set of data and/or applications corresponds.
The processing and control unit CPU is operatively connected to read/write means R/W which may be coupled to a storage medium of card C which can be associated with the apparatus for transferring a complete selected set of data and/or applications, stored into a memory module M, to card C, blank or temporarily devoid of data and/or programming procedures, so as to program said card for a predetermined service destination identified by said set of data or procedures, or for acquiring a complete current set of data and/or applications resident (stored) on said card C and the consequent storage of a complete updated set of data or applications in a corresponding memory module M, relating to the current service destination of the card, in view of a subsequent service programming of the same or another card.
Encryption algorithms adapted to encrypt or decrypt a set of data or applications according to one of a plurality of predetermined protocols depending upon the programmed service destination of the card may advantageously be executed by the processing and control unit CPU.
The read/write means RAV include, for example but not exclusively, contact terminals with a micro-circuit embedded on the card, a magnetic head adapted to interact with a magnetic band incorporated in the card, optical devices adapted to interact with at least one optical track engraved onto the card, or means for transmitting and receiving radio signals adapted to remotely exchange data with the storage medium of a proximity card.
Advantageously, apparatus P is arranged for automatically recognizing the coupling of a card C therewith, thus the control and processing unit CPU is adapted to acquire from the storage medium 50 of card C associated with apparatus P the complete current set of data and/or applications resident on the card C, and store said set in a memory area of the integrated memory modules M, corresponding to the programming related to the current service destination of the card.
In an initialisation procedure, the control and processing unit CPU is adapted to assign a new memory area in the integrated memory modules M, for storing a complete set of data and/or applications for identifying a new programming configuration of electronic card C, for example previously acquired from the storage medium of a different, original card having a unique and unchangeable functional destination, or transmitted by wire or radio by the supplier of the original card or by the provider of the respective service in favour of an authorised subject.
According to a preferred embodiment of the invention, the control and processing unit CPU is conveniently adapted for automatically deleting the complete set of data and procedures stored on the storage medium of the card subsequent to the transfer thereof to the integrated memory M of apparatus P.
Since the memory means M of apparatus P would store an amount of confidential information relating to the user, it may be conveniently provided for the processing and control unit CPU to be arranged for deleting the sets of data stored in the memory means M of apparatus P subsequent to a remote command, such as a command for disabling the use of the telephone apparatus, or automatically, subsequent to the occurrence of predetermined use conditions, for example the repeated input of an incorrect apparatus unlock code. This is to prevent the stealing of the telephone apparatus from allowing ill- intentioned people to come to know personal information for carrying out frauds to the detriment of the owner of the multi-purpose electronic card.
Of course, the integrated memory means M of apparatus P are accessible in reading from the outside, for transferring the sets of data and/or applications to another electronic device, for example in case of replacement of the telephone apparatus, or saving a backup copy of such sets on a mass storage medium.
According to a further advantageous embodiment of the invention, the control and processing unit is arranged for keeping track of the operations performed with card C in at least one predetermined service configuration, for example for performing accounting (billing) operations related to the services accessed by means of the card.
With reference to the schematic view of Figure 2, below is a summary of the method for using a service delivered by a provider to a user showing an electronic card having stored therein a set of data and/or applications functional to said service.
First, the user selects, from the integrated memory modules M of the telephone apparatus P (or similar electronic portable device), a complete set of data and/or applications identifying a desired programming configuration of the electronic card C, that is, for assigning a predetermined functional destination to card C adapted for making said card operational for the selected service.
Then, the electronic programmable card C is temporarily associated to apparatus P, for allowing the transfer, from the memory means M of the apparatus to the storage medium 50 of the card, of the selected set of data and/or applications, so as to program the above card for the predetermined service destination identified by said collection of data or applications. The selection and transfer of the selected complete set of data and/or applications takes place preserving the contents inaccessibility, that is, the user has no possibility of changing even partially such data and/or applications, but he may only require the transfer of the complete set to the card.
Subsequent to the extraction or impairing of the apparatus, the programmed card C is subject to reading/writing by a card access device CA associated with the desired service provider, adapted for verifying the credentials of the card owner and authorising or denying access to the service. This step is shown by way of graphics in Figure 2 by scenes A and B, where card C thus programmed is used to access a place subject to restrictions (scene A) through a surveilled passage 100 or for executing a financial transaction at an automatic teller machine (ATM) 200 (scene B).
Within the scope of use of the card programmed to access a service and make use of it, the user has the faculty of modifying at least partially the data and/or applications resident on the card, for example modifying a password, in accordance with the possibilities offered by the service provider, which are not the subject of the present description.
Once the service has been used, for those particular cases wherein updated data are stored on the storage medium of the card by the service provider, the current complete set of data and/or applications stored on the card is transferred to the integrated memory means M of apparatus P, again without the possibility of changing by a user, so as to store an updated set of data and/or applications thereon, for a correct use of the card with the same service destination at a later time.
